Abstract

The invention relates to the technical field related to straw bundling and discloses an agricultural garbage straw bundling device which comprises a rack, wherein walking wheels are movably mounted on two sides of the rack, an input shaft is movably mounted in the middle of the surface of the rack, a gear box fixedly mounted with the input shaft is fixedly mounted at the top of the inner wall of the rack, and output shafts at two ends of the gear box are respectively and fixedly mounted with winding rollers. The straw pressing machine is provided with the compression roller movably mounted with the walking wheels, and the walking wheels are movably connected with the rack through the adjusting frame, so that the straw is compressed through the self-gravity of the rack under the action of the self-gravity of the rack on the compression roller and is extruded through the compression roller in the straw pressing process, the application of hydraulic extrusion of the straw is avoided, the energy consumption is reduced, meanwhile, the interaction force between the self-gravity of the rack and the straw is automatically improved, and the purposes of self-adapting straw extrusion and energy consumption reduction are finally achieved.

Background
The straw bundling machine mainly picks up and bundles straws such as rice straws, bean stalks and the like and pasture, has multiple matching functions, can directly pick up and bundle, can also pick up and bundle after being cut, and can also smash and bundle firstly.
The existing bundling device directly picked up is mainly divided into two parts, namely a pickup device and a rolling and bundling device, so that the working principle of the bundling device is mainly as follows: the method comprises the steps that firstly, a pickup device picks up the straws on the ground to a bundled material conveying bag, then, the straws are extruded and bundled through a winding roller and a rope bundling machine in a bundling device, so that the straws are cylindrical after being processed, and the straws are bundled by the rope bundling machine and then discharged to the ground.
However, in the actual use process, the straws have a certain gap after being rolled, so that the straws which are hydraulically extruded are rolled, and a certain gap still exists between the straws in the rolling process, so that the bundled straws are in a loose state, and the subsequent carrying and conveying are not facilitated.
Meanwhile, the continuous hydraulic pressure can not be well adapted to straws with different thicknesses, and the workload of the hydraulic press is increased through the continuous feeding and discharging of the hydraulic pressure, so that the cost in the production process is increased.

Referring to fig. 1-7, an agricultural garbage straw bundling device comprises a frame 1, traveling wheels 2 movably mounted on two sides of the frame 1, an input shaft 3 movably mounted in the middle of the surface of the frame 1, a gear box 4 fixedly mounted with the input shaft 3 and fixedly mounted on the top of the inner wall of the frame 1, winding rollers 5 fixedly mounted on output shafts of two ends of the gear box 4, threaded connecting rods 7 movably mounted on two sides of the surface of the frame 1, a rope threading device 8 fixedly mounted on the top of the surface of the frame 1, a material conveying frame 6 positioned on one side of the traveling wheels 2 and movably mounted on the bottom of the frame 1, adjusting frames 9 movably mounted on two sides of the frame 1, a balance frame 11 fixedly mounted on the middle of the surface of the frame 1, two sides of the balance frame 11 movably mounted with the adjusting frames 9, traveling wheels 2 movably mounted on the surfaces of the two adjusting frames 9, and a compression roller 10 movably mounted on the rotating shafts of the two traveling wheels 2 and, fixing rods 12 are respectively and fixedly arranged on two sides of one end of the material conveying frame 6, the material conveying frame 6 is movably arranged with the rack 1 through the fixing rods 12, the top ends of the fixing rods 12 are coaxial with the mounting part of one end of the threaded connecting rod 7, a reversing roller 13 is movably arranged on the inner wall of the rack 1, in order to achieve the purposes of self-adaptive straw extrusion and energy consumption reduction, the walking wheels 2 are movably arranged with the rack 1, therefore, in the working process, the walking wheels 2 deflect towards two sides through the self-gravity of the rack 1, further, the height of the compression roller 10 and the ground is reduced, meanwhile, the straws are placed on the material conveying frame 6, the straws can be extruded through the compression roller 10, further, the extrusion of the straws is realized through the self-stress of the rack 1, the energy consumption required by the extrusion of the straws can be reduced, further, the use of a hydraulic system, in order to ensure that the rack 1 is more stable in the process of enabling the walking wheels 2 to fall, the balance frame 11 is arranged for maintaining balance, and the height of the straws between the material conveying frame 6 and the compression roller 10 is changed, so that the compression roller 10 can independently extrude the straws with different heights through the self-gravity of the rack 1 to the compression roller 10 and the relative acting force of the height of the straws to the compression roller 10, and finally the purposes of self-adapting straw extrusion and energy consumption reduction are achieved.
Wherein, the two sides of the top end of the material conveying frame 6 are respectively fixedly provided with a hydraulic cylinder 15, the top ends of the two hydraulic cylinders 15 are respectively movably provided with a tensioning belt 16, the top end of the tensioning belt 16 is fixedly arranged with the top of the inner wall of the frame 1, and the surface of the tensioning belt 16 is fixedly provided with a reversing roller 13, in order to achieve the purpose of preventing the straw from loosing, therefore, one end of the material conveying frame 6 is fixedly provided with the hydraulic cylinder 15, the top of the hydraulic cylinder 15 is provided with the tensioning belt 16, the hydraulic cylinder 15 can lift the material conveying frame 6 through the reversing roller 13 on the tensioning belt 16, therefore, in the bundling process, the straw can be firstly extruded for the first time through the compression roller 10, secondly, when the straw is wound, the reversing roller 13 can always adhere to the outer wall of the straw, and when the diameter of the straw is continuously increased, the acting force of the straw on the reversing roller 13 is relatively increased, so that the extrusion force of the reversing roller 13 can be enhanced in the process of winding the straws, the gaps between the straws can be avoided, and meanwhile, when the diameter of the straws is continuously increased, the opposite force of the reversing roller 13 is also relatively increased, so that the hydraulic cylinder 15 can lift the feeding frame 6 upwards through the outward tension of the reversing roller 13 on the tensioning belt 16, so that the straw has a rolling space, and simultaneously, the distance between the material conveying frame 6 and the press roll 10 is shortened, further enhancing the force of the compression roller 10 to extrude the straws, so that the material conveying frame 6 jacks up the compression roller 10 through the straws, the walking wheels 2 tend to be vertical to the ground, and finally the straws are rolled up, the straws are always extruded by the self-gravity of the frame 1, so that the phenomenon that the straws are loosened after being bundled is avoided, and the aim of preventing the straws from being loosened is finally fulfilled.

The using method of the invention has the following working principle:
the installation state is as follows: firstly, the threaded connecting rod 7 is installed on an output shaft of an agricultural machine (not shown in the figure), and secondly, the front section of the material conveying frame 6 is placed on the ground at a proper height by installing the threaded connecting rod 7 on a lifting rod of the agricultural machine and adjusting the length of the threaded connecting rod 7;
and (3) extruding: the frame 1 is driven to move forwards by an agricultural machine, a pickup device (not shown) at the front section of the material conveying frame 6 picks straws onto the material conveying frame 6, meanwhile, under the influence of the self gravity of the frame 1, the travelling wheels 2 can incline towards two sides, so that the compression roller 10 is arranged above the material conveying frame 6, when straws exist on the material conveying frame 6, the straws are extruded onto the material conveying frame 6 through the compression roller 10, the material conveying frame 6 is contacted with the ground through the ground wheels 14, sufficient extrusion force is provided between the material conveying frame 6 and the compression roller 10 to extrude the straws on the material conveying frame 6, and meanwhile, the compression roller 10 is in transmission connection with the travelling wheels 2, so that when the travelling wheels 2 rotate on the ground, the compression roller 10 synchronously rotates, the straws are extruded, and the extruded straws are conveyed to the upper part;
bundling state: after the extruded straws on the material conveying frame 6 are conveyed to the upper part through the compression roller 10, the straws are rotated and rolled up through the reversing roller 13, meanwhile, the input shaft 3 of the straw rolling machine enables the gear box 4 to continuously rotate through the gear box 4 and contacts with the outer wall of the extruded straws, so that the straws continuously rotate, when the continuous rolling diameter of the straws is increased, the outer wall of the straws is contacted with the reversing roller 13, further the reversing roller 13 outwards supports the tensioning belt 16 and is connected with the hydraulic cylinder 15 through the tensioning belt 16, so that the straws on the rolling roller 5 are continuously increased by the binding force of the reversing roller 13, and then when the diameter of the straws is continuously increased, the reversing roller 13 is outwards extruded, further the reversing roller 13 enables the hydraulic cylinder 15 to lift one end of the material conveying frame 6 through the tensioning belt 16, so that the rollable diameter of the straws is increased, meanwhile, the distance between the material conveying frames 6 and the compression roller 10 is relatively shortened, make the great reinforcing to the extrusion force of straw, later, when the power of dragging of its pneumatic cylinder 15 increases, can make the straw jack-up compression roller 10 through its defeated material frame 6, and then make both sides walking wheel 2 outwards move, make walking wheel 2 tend to perpendicularly with the outside, later, after binding to certain diameter after its straw, bind the straw through its threading device 8, and make the taut band 16 drive reversing roll 13 through the ejecting of pneumatic cylinder 15 and promote, make the straw roll out, later, again through the shrink of its pneumatic cylinder 15, make pneumatic cylinder 15 withdraw its reversing roll 13, operate according to foretell step once more, make the straw can be once more rolled up.
